[ARCHIVED] Want to swim competitively? Sign up with the Elgin Cyclones

The Elgin Cyclones Swim Team is one of the areas’ fastest-growing teams, teaching both the new and experienced swimmers with our outstanding coaching staff; and we’re looking for new swimmers.

The Cyclones will be accepting new swimmer registrations on April 7 at The Centre of Elgin, 100 Symphony Way in downtown Elgin.

New swimmers will be evaluated from 10 a.m. to noon, April 7, where swimmers will be assigned a workout group for the summer based on their age and ability.

This is not a tryout — all those who are interested will be placed on the team. The cost for the team is dependent upon workout group and ranges. All swimmers also must join USA Swimming.

The Elgin Cyclones Swim Team believes individual improvement breeds success and that winning comes with improvement. Your swimmer will improve throughout the course of the summer, and improvement means progress. The team has been very successful with numerous regional and senior championships, and state qualifiers in age groups.

If your swimmers want to improve their skills, sign them up April 7.
